Why Visa Gift Cards Can Be Tricky
Verification Blues
One of the biggest hurdles is verification. OnlyFans needs to verify that the payment method you're using is, well, you. This often involves matching the name and address on the card with the information you've provided. With a typical Visa gift card, there's often no name attached to it, or it has a generic name like "Gift Recipient."
This lack of identifiable information can trigger flags with OnlyFans' payment processing system. They might suspect fraudulent activity, and nobody wants their account locked.
Address Mismatch Mayhem
Similar to the name issue, the billing address can also be problematic. Often, Visa gift cards don't have a specific address registered to them unless you register it yourself online after purchasing. If you haven't registered the gift card with an address, OnlyFans (or their payment processor) won't be able to verify it, leading to a failed transaction.
Think of it like this: it's like trying to order something online without putting in your shipping address. It's just not going to work.
International Payment Issues
Sometimes, Visa gift cards are restricted to use within the country of purchase. If you're trying to subscribe to an OnlyFans creator who is located in a different country, this restriction might prevent the transaction from going through. While less common these days, it's still a possibility worth considering.
So, Is There Any Hope?
Don't despair! While it's not a guaranteed success, there are things you can try:
Register Your Gift Card!
This is the most important step. Most Visa gift cards have a website or phone number printed on the back. Go to the website and register the card using your name and address. This will significantly increase your chances of the payment being accepted by OnlyFans. It essentially turns the card into something more akin to a prepaid debit card.
Trying a Prepaid Debit Card Instead
Speaking of prepaid debit cards, consider getting one specifically designed for online use. These cards are often reloadable and allow you to register your information, making them more easily verifiable. Think of it as a step up from a standard gift card.

Using a Privacy Service/Virtual Card
Services like Privacy.com allow you to create virtual debit cards that are linked to your bank account but can be used for specific transactions or subscriptions. This provides an extra layer of security and privacy, as your actual card details aren't directly exposed. You can even set spending limits on the virtual card, which is a nice feature.
